> I am unable to use Firefox ESR with an antivirus product portal, but the > web site works fine with the Rapid Release version. Are there differences > between the products that I am missing? The symptom I see that that I can > logon the portal, but if I try to use functionality on the site I see that > I get a 403 error when reviewing the Developer console (Network). So I can > navigate and use most of the portal, but if I wanted to use any of the > functions that require checking a checkbox and clicking on a button to > perform some action, it gives a generic error message outside of the > Developer console (Network). > > > > I removed all of our policies and preferences for ESR. I verified that > the privacy settings are not blocking anything by selecting Custom and > unchecking everything. I even installed ESR on my home PC in a similar > fashion and duplicated the issue with similar results. As usual our friend > Chrome works… Support is less than helpful from the antivirus vendor. My > position has been that if the web site gives me a 403, the web site is > responsible for the problem. > > > > Method Not Allowed > > > > The method is not allowed for the requested URL. > That's really odd. Can you try aa user agent switcher https://addons.mozilla.org/en-US/firefox/addon/user-agent-string-switcher/ That would tell you if the problem was that the website was because they were explicitly checking the version. I agree a 403 usually indicates a website problem. If you let us know the site, I can have the webcompat team take a look.
